Dr. Rukmani Kannan M.A., M.Phil and Ph.D in music, a trained music teacher. She had her teacher's training at the Music Academy, Madras. She had her initial vocal and veena lessons from her aunt Smt. Geetha Ragunathan and later continued veena lessons from Salem G. Desikan and Smt. Nirmala Parthasarathi. She continued her vocal lessons from various gurus and at present having vocal guidance from Kalaimamani Dr. Prema Rangarajan. She has given performances on veena in various sabhas in Chennai. She has also given vocal performances in sabhas, shrines and social get togethers. She has been awarded the Senior fellowship by Ministry of Culture, Government of India, for her project "An insight into the Contribution of yesteryear Vainikas to Carnatic music". She has also presented papers and lecture demonstrations in many National and International Music Conferences held in Mysore, Bangalore, Madurai and few more.
